简要总结
This is a Prospective, single-center, randomized, controlled, paired-eye, single-masked clinical investigation to compare the efficacy and safety of FIDIAL PLUS (bacterial derived 1.8% sodium hyaluronate OVD) and IAL®-F (comparable animal derived 1.8% sodium hyaluronate OVD) while used during phacoemulsification cataract surgery.
详细描述
Viscoelastics, also referred to as OVDs (ophthalmic viscosurgical devices), are viscous substances that are routinely used in cataract surgery. The most basic benefit of OVD use in ophthalmic surgery is maintaining the anterior chamber during surgical maneuvers. One of the main aspects in OVD use remains the protection of intraocular structures and in particular of corneal endothelium cells (CECs) during cataract surgery.

结局指标
主要结局
Change of corneal endothelium cell density after phacoemulsification cataract surgery with use of two different OVD (Ophthalmic Viscosurgical Devices)
时间窗: 28 days per eye
This outcome will be calculated as percentage of corneal endothelial cells loss at day 28 (T3/T6) when compared with baseline (T0). This will be assessed as a paired t-test comparing the mean percentage change of FIDIAL PLUS against the mean percentage change from baseline of IAL®-F at Day 28. Corneal endothelial cell density will be measured by non-contact specular microscopy.
